Günlük hayatta birçok kişinin bir program ya da bir yazılım üzerinde çalıştığını görmüşsünüzdür. Bir çoğunuz da programlama öğrenme istediği doğmuş ancak nereden başlayacağını bilmediği için vazgeçmiş olabilir. Yeni başlayan biri programlama öğrenme için nelere dikkat etmeli?

Program, belirli bir amaca hizmet eden ve kullanıcılardan almış oldukları verileri işleyerek bir çıktıya dönüştüren yazılımsal bir uygulamadır. Programlar parçadan bütüne oluşturulmuş olan bir uygulamalardır. Hiçbir program bir anda ortaya çıkmaz altında yatan çok fazla emek ve parçadan bütüne bir ilişki vardır.

Kodlama Nedir ? Kodlamanın Önemi Nedir?



Karar Verme

Programlama çok geniş kapsamı olan bir alandır.  Programlama öğrenmek için önce hangi alanda çalışmak istediğinize karar vermeniz gerekmektedir. Web tasarımı mı yapacaksınız yoksa nesne tabanlı bir programlama mı önce buna karar vermeniz gerekiyor. Bu iki platform birbirlerinden bağımsız yapıya sahiptirler.

Hangi Programlama Dilini Seçmeliyim?

Bu sorunun kesin bir cevabı bulunmuyor. Gerçekleştireceğiniz işlemleri birden fazla programlama dili ile gerçekleştirebilirsiniz. Programlama alanı alternatifleri bol bir alandır. .net dilleri ile bir programlama gerçekleştirmek istiyorsanız bu sizi maddi açıdan biraz zorlayabilir. Zira Microsoft yazılım geliştirme araçlarını ücretli olarak kullanıcılarını sunuyor. Bu ücreti karşılayacak durumunuz yoksa alternatif yazılım araçlarına göz atabilirsiniz. Bu alternatifleri yine sizin hangi dalda çalışacağınız belirliyor olacaktır.

Programlama Dilini Seçtim Nasıl Öğrenmeye Başlayabilirim?

Bir programlama dilini öğrenmek istiyorsanız dikkat etmeniz gereken en önemli husus ezber yapmamak olmalı. Ezber yaptığınız durumlarda sistemin mantığını asla öğrenemezsiniz. Karşınıza çıkabilecek en küçük problemi bile çözemezsiniz.

İlk olarak kullanmış olduğunuz programlama dilinin syntax’ını öğrenmekten başlayın. Syntax’ları öğrenmek için internet üzerinde bulunan videolardan faydalanabilirsiniz. Ücretli olarak içerikleri satın almanıza gerek buluyor. İnternet ortamında ücretsiz olarak faydalanabileceğiniz içerikler bulabilirsiniz. İçerikleri öğrenmeye başlarken adım adım ilerleyin ve günlük olarak sürekli önceki dönemlerde öğrenmiş olduklarınızı tekrar edin. Tekrar yaparken ezber yöntemi yerine öğrendikleriniz ile ilgili uygulamalar gerçekleştirmeye çalışın bu daha faydalı olacaktır. Uygulamayı geliştirirken alacağınız hatalar ve o hataların çözümü için yapacağınız araştırmalar sizlere yeni bilgiler öğrenmenizi sağlayacaktır.

 

 

 

 

 

 

 

Programınızı tasarlarken almış olduğunuz hataların çözümü için yabancı kaynakları mutlaka inceleyin. Yabancı kaynakların daha yararlı olacağını göreceksinizdir. Ayrıca bir problemin çözümünü birden fazla olabileceğini unutmayın. Alternatif çözümler için sürekli araştırma yapın.

Seçmiş olduğunuz alan ile ilgili olarak kafanızda mutlaka bir proje olsun. Her gün öğrendikleriniz ile bu projenin belirli kısımlarını yapmaya çalışın. Hiçbir program ya da yazılımın bir anda ortaya çıkmadığını emek ve sabır karşılığında ortaya çıkmadığını unutmayın. Küçük adımlar atarak ilerleyin. Atmış olduğunuz adımı başarıyla gerçekleştirdiğinizde motivasyonunuzun da artmış olduğunuzu göreceksiniz.

Bildiğiniz gibi programlama dilleri İngilizce tabanlıdır. Programlamaya başlamadan önce ya da programlama öğrenme süreciniz içerisinde İngilizce dil bilginizi geliştirmeye çalışın böylelikle programlama öğrenmenin çok zor olmadığını göreceksiniz.

Bir cevap yazın

E-posta hesabınız yayımlanmayacak. Gerekli alanlar * ile işaretlenmişlerdir

*
*